Blue Tile Prices in Mughalsarai-Chandauli
| Tile Type | Finish | Price Range (Rs./sq.ft) | Best Application |
|---|---|---|---|
| Basic Ceramic Blue (wall only) | Matte/Glossy | Rs. 36 to Rs. 49 | Bathroom and kitchen walls |
| Glazed Vitrified Blue | Polished/Satin | Rs. 46 to Rs. 89 | Living rooms, premium walls |
| Colour Body / Premium Blue Decor | Polished/Textured | Rs. 43 to Rs. 79 | Feature walls, bathroom walls |
| Large Format / Bookmatch Blue | Polished High Glossy | Rs. 131 to Rs. 236 | Luxury living rooms, lobbies |
| Anti-Skid Outdoor Blue | Rustic/Punch | Rs. 51 to Rs. 106 | Balconies, terraces, outdoor |
Note: Prices exclude GST at 18% and local transport charges. Transport from Morbi, Gujarat, to Mughalsarai-Chandauli adds Rs. 2 to Rs. 5 per sq.ft over ex-factory rates.
Best Uses of Blue Tiles in Mughalsarai-Chandauli Homes and Projects
Blue tiles are a classic choice for bathrooms and wet zones in Mughalsarai-Chandauli homes, providing a cool and clean aesthetic. For bathroom floors, buyers look for anti-skid or textured finishes, while glossy or satin blue ceramic tiles are preferred for walls. Kitchen backsplashes and utility areas also benefit from blue tiles, adding a pop of colour to neutral kitchen designs while remaining practical and easy to clean. Deep blue marble-look, bookmatch, or 3D blue tiles create striking focal walls in living rooms and TV units, offering a touch of sophistication. For balconies and outdoor terraces, textured blue vitrified tiles work well, providing both visual appeal and necessary slip resistance, especially during the monsoon season. Choosing the Right Blue Tiles in Mughalsarai-Chandauli
When selecting blue tiles in Mughalsarai-Chandauli, several factors guide local preferences. The hot-humid climate often leads buyers to prefer lighter shades of blue and matte finishes for floors, as they absorb less heat and offer better grip. For walls, especially in bathrooms and kitchens, glossy blue ceramic tiles are common for their easy maintenance and bright appearance. Many homeowners are upgrading from older mosaic or cement tiles, opting for the superior finish and longevity of GVT or Full Body vitrified tiles. These modern options offer better colour fastness and lower water absorption. Dealer clusters around the Grand Trunk Road and local building material markets in Chandauli offer a range of options, from basic ceramic wall tiles to premium large-format vitrified blue tiles, all manufactured in Morbi, Gujarat. Maintenance Tips for Blue Tiles in Mughalsarai-Chandauli
Maintaining blue tiles in Mughalsarai-Chandauli is straightforward, ensuring they retain their fresh appearance for years. Regular cleaning with a mild detergent and soft cloth keeps both glossy and matte surfaces free from dirt. For wet areas like bathrooms, using colour-matched epoxy grout is important to prevent discoloration and enhance the tile's visual appeal. The anti-skid properties of textured blue tiles, particularly vital during the monsoon, should be preserved by avoiding harsh chemicals that can degrade the surface. For blue living room tiles, routine dusting and occasional wet mopping help maintain their lustre. Promptly addressing spills prevents stains, especially on lighter shades. For optimal performance in Mughalsarai-Chandauli's climate, blue vitrified tiles typically have a water absorption rate of less than 0.05%, making them highly resistant to moisture. Popular sizes like 600x1200 mm (2x4) and 600x600 mm (2x2) are widely used for floors, with prices ranging from Rs. 46 to Rs. 89 per sq.ft for standard glazed vitrified options. These come in various body types, including GVT and Full Body, suitable for both residential and commercial applications.
Blue tiles sourced from Morbi, Gujarat, are a reliable choice for Mughalsarai-Chandauli, offering robust performance against the region's monsoon conditions. Their availability in anti-skid and textured finishes makes them well-suited for outdoor areas and wet zones, ensuring safety and longevity. For ceramic wall tiles, the IS 13630 standard ensures acceptable quality for interior wall cladding.
